Baseline practical settings
Start with a clean slate in full screen mode and set a reasonable frame rate cap based on your hardware. The goal is consistent responsiveness rather than chasing ultra high visuals at the expense of stutter. If you are on a mid range rig, a stable 60 fps is a solid target; stronger hardware can push further with careful tuning.
- Keep render resolution at native or slightly lower if stutter appears during intense scenes
- Choose an anti aliasing method that balances clarity and performance such as TAA
- Texture quality should be high if your VRAM allows it; otherwise moderate texture detail helps avoid texture streaming hiccups
- Shadow quality is a major drain; set it to medium or low to reclaim frame time without sacrificing too much immersion
- Disable motion blur and excessive post processing to sharpen visibility during fights and encounters
Display and rendering tips
The biggest gains come from dialing down rendering costs in shadows reflections and global illumination. If your game offers resolution scaling or GPU upscaling options use them to maintain crisp output while rendering fewer internal frames. For many players this yields a sweeter balance between image fidelity and frame stability.
- Shadow quality medium
- Reflections set to low or off if necessary
- Global illumination off when performance is tight
- Field of view kept near default to avoid extra rendering load while preserving peripheral awareness
System specific tweaks
On machines with a mix of CPU and GPU power you can often push texture and effect settings higher while maintaining frame stability. If your CPU shows signs of strain in crowded scenes, lean on lower shadows and reduced post processing to keep inputs snappy. Regular driver updates from Nvidia or AMD can also shave precious milliseconds from frame times.
- Update graphics drivers before a new play session
- Keep VRAM usage under control by balancing texture and effect settings
- Turn off vertical synchronization if you rely on adaptive sync and crave lower input latency
